PITTSBURGH – A federal magistrate judge has recommended that a Pennsylvania federal court not approve the Diocese of Greensburg’s attempt to dismiss litigation from a sixth-grade teacher allegedly fired from Aquinas Academy, once his employer learned of his same-sex marriage.

PITTSBURGH – A sixth-grade teacher allegedly fired from Aquinas Academy once his employer learned of his same-sex marriage rejected the Diocese of Greensburg’s attempt to dismiss his case via its perceived exemption from anti-discrimination laws.
PITTSBURGH – A Catholic diocese in Pennsylvania alleges it was within its rights to terminate a teacher’s employment once it learned of his same-sex marriage, since it feels that its position as a religious institution exempts it from federal anti-discrimination laws.
